如何处理数据库压缩和归档过程中的错误
一、引言
在处理数据库压缩和归档过程中,错误是难以避免的。这些错误可能由于人为失误、硬件故障、网络问题或软件错误等原因引起。为了保护数据库的完整性和可靠性,我们需要采取合适的措施来及时发现和处理这些错误,以便尽快恢复数据库并最大程度地减少数据损失。
二、错误类型和常见原因
1. 数据丢失:这种错误可能由于文件损坏、删除操作失误或硬件故障等原因引起。例如,误操作导致重要数据被删除或覆盖。
2. 数据库不一致:当进行数据压缩和归档时,若操作不当或软件故障可能导致数据库的一致性破坏。这种情况下,数据库中的数据可能出现错位、丢失或冗余。
3. 网络故障:网络故障可能会中断数据库操作,导致数据压缩和归档过程中的错误。例如,网络连接中断,或者远程服务器不可用。
4. 硬件故障:硬件故障是导致数据库错误的另一个常见原因。例如,存储设备故障、电源故障或服务器崩溃等。
三、处理错误的步骤
1. 发现错误:通过监控系统或数据库日志,我们可以及时发现数据库压缩和归档过程中的错误。此外,定期进行数据库的备份和校验也是发现错误的有效手段。
2. 制定应急预案:一旦发现错误,我们应立即采取应急预案,以尽快恢复数据库并最小化数据损失。例如,如果发生数据丢失,我们可以恢复最近的备份,并尽快恢复丢失的数据。
3. 分析错误原因:在处理错误之前,我们需要进行仔细的分析,出错误发生的原因。这可以帮助我们避免同样的错误再次发生。
4. 修复和恢复:根据错误的类型和原因,我们可以采取相应的措施来修复数据库和恢复数据。例如,对于文件损坏导致的数据丢失,我们可以通过数据恢复软件来尝试恢复损坏的文件。
5. 调整数据库策略:在处理错误之后,我们需要对数据库策略进行适当的调整,以预防类似错误的再次发生。例如,加强权限控制、定期备份数据、检查硬件设备等。
四、错误处理的实践经验
1. 建立监控系统:通过建立监控系统,及时发现数据库错误。监控系统可以跟踪数据库性能,检测错误并发送警报,以便及时采取措施。
2. 定期备份和校验数据:定期备份数据是防止数据丢失和错误的重要手段。另外,备份数据应进行校验,以确保备份数据的完整性和可用性。
3. 定期更新软件和硬件设备:及时更新软件和硬件设备可以帮助减少错误的发生。新版本的软件和设备通常具有更好的稳定性和性能。
4. 建立灾难恢复计划:在数据库出现严重故障时,建立灾难恢复计划可以帮助快速有效地恢复数据库。该计划应包括明确的恢复步骤和备用设备。
五、结论
数据库怎么备份数据
处理数据库压缩和归档过程中的错误是数据库管理的重要任务之一。通过建立监控系统、定期备份数据、及时更新软件和硬件设备,并制定应急预案和灾难恢复计划等措施,我们可以更好地应对数据库错误,并尽快恢复数据。同时,合理调整数据库策略和加强系统安全性也是减少错误发生的重要措施。只有不断总结经验,并积极采取措施来预防和处理错误,才能保证数据库的安全性和稳定性。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论